Bonide Systemic Insect Control Granules provide up to 8 weeks of effective, low-odor insect protection by absorbing into plant roots and moving systemically. Designed for outdoor plants, it targets sap-feeding pests such as aphids and mealybugs without harming beneficial insects. Ready-to-use granules are easy to apply and remain effective even after watering, making it an essential solution for maintaining a healthy, pest-free garden.

better than the 8-oz bottle
Bonide (BND95349) - Insect Control Systemic Granules, 0.22% Imidacloprid Insecticide (4 lb.) I first got Bonide BND951 which is an 8-oz bottle of 0.22% Imidacloprid marked "for containerized plants". It was very effective in getting rid of /controlling scales and thrips on my 50+ indoor plants but I didn't want to keep paying $9 for just 8 oz of the insecticide. Bonide (BND95349) is also labelled as containing 0.22% Imidacloprid Insecticide but is marked "for use outdoors on flower beds, roses and shrubs". It still contains the same concentration of Imidacloprid as Bonide BND951 so I got it and used it/am using it on my indoor plants. I wish companies would just stop it with the package size price gouging. Really? $9 for 8 oz while a 4-lb (64 oz) bottle is $19.99? There's another product that contains 0.22% imidacloprid - BioAdvanced 5 lb. 2-in-1 Systemic Rose and Flower Care Ready-to-Use Granules. However, there's another version of it which contains acephate instead of imidacloprid. I didn't know there were two versions when I ordered it. My experience from ordering it from HD, is that they will ship the version that's allowed in your state for outdoor use. They will not tell the customer that theyโre not going to send the item ordered (as advertised) but will send a substitute/different version. Unfortunately, imidacloprid is banned in Illinois for outdoor use so I received the acephate version which is very very stinky (not suitable for use indoors). That went back to HD and I went back to Amazon to order Bonide (BND95349). I wasn't going to take a chance on ordering the BioAdvanced item from Amazon in case Amazon does the same and sends me the acephate version. I understand the danger to pollinators but my plants are all indoors, behind screened windows and doors, and so will never encounter pollinators. I wish regulations consider where people are going to use a product. I also understand though that some people are probably going to lie about where they're going to use a product.

K**S
Stay ahead of the pesties with these granules
We have a houseplant obsession so plant pests are always an issue. They come in from outside, they hop on the houseplants I put out on the deck for the summer, they ride in on newly purchase plants and plants from friends. I recommend using this product for every new plant you get. I add granules every 2 mos to my babies who are susceptible to spider mites and mealies. Last year I had thrips for the first time and those little monsters do some big damage. Bonide took care of them. I don't notice an odor. I appreciate the larger quantity and although others mention reduced quantity, I know the granules settle and we go by weight. It's a durable product in scope of plants it can be used with as well as pests it controls. I've never had a leaking jug. It has clear instruction and more info is available on the company site. I know it's not a natural product, but for houseplants I'm not ingesting it's reasonable.
